814 Analyze A Usb Keylogger Attack 814 Analyze a USB Keylogger Attack Understanding and countering USB keyloggers is crucial in todays digital landscape This article delves into the intricacies of a USB keylogger attack providing a comprehensive analysis of its methods effects and countermeasures What is a USB Keylogger A USB keylogger is a malicious piece of software disguised as a legitimate USB drive Its designed to record keystrokes and other data input from the victims computer These devices can be physically inserted into a computer often appearing innocuous luring unsuspecting users into connecting them The data collected by the keylogger is then transmitted to a remote attacker How a USB Keylogger Attack Works Physical Insertion The attacker strategically places the keylogger device It might be disguised as a legitimate flash drive a USB hub or even a seemingly harmless device This is often done covertly potentially unnoticed by the victim until significant data has been collected Data Capture Once connected the keylogger silently captures all keystrokes passwords usernames credit card information and other sensitive data This data is stored on the device itself often encrypted to protect it from casual users Transmission Depending on the sophistication of the keylogger the captured data might be transmitted to a remote server or a commandandcontrol CC center in realtime or on a scheduled basis Sophisticated keyloggers might utilize obfuscation techniques to mask their activities and evade detection Stealth and Evasion Keyloggers often employ techniques to avoid detection such as disabling antivirus software or running in the background The attackers meticulous planning and a lack of awareness from the victim are essential factors for success Types of Data Collected Personal Information Usernames passwords email addresses social security numbers Financial Data Credit card numbers bank account details PINs Sensitive Documents Confidential reports business documents intellectual property Keystrokes and Typed Text This information can be crucial for compromising accounts and 2 accessing private data Detecting a USB Keylogger Attack Unusual Activity Monitor for any unexpected behavior such as unusually high CPU usage slow performance or unusual network traffic A constantly active USB drive even after disconnecting from the host system might also be a red flag System Monitoring Tools Specialized security software can monitor file activity and network connections Security Software Robust antivirus and antimalware solutions can detect and remove keyloggers from the system Visual Inspection Carefully examine the physical USB device to ensure there arent any unusual components or extra connections Countermeasures and Prevention Education and Awareness Educate employees about the risks of unfamiliar USB devices and the importance of verifying the legitimacy of any device before plugging it into a computer system Secure Storage Practices Implement strict security policies in the workplace and at home restricting access to sensitive data Regular Security Software Updates Keep antivirus and antimalware solutions updated to identify and neutralize the latest threats Implementing Security Policies Create comprehensive security policies that cover USB usage and data handling Using Strong Passwords The importance of employing strong unique passwords cannot be understated Virtualization for Testing Use virtualization software to test USB drives in a contained environment before connecting them to primary systems Analyzing the Impact of a USB Keylogger Attack Financial Losses Unauthorized access to financial accounts can result in substantial financial losses Reputational Damage Compromised data can lead to severe damage to personal and professional reputations Legal Consequences Unauthorized access to confidential information might lead to legal repercussions Data Breach Stolen information can be misused leading to significant data breaches 3 Key Takeaways USB keyloggers represent a significant security threat Prevention through education and policy is crucial Quick detection and response strategies are necessary Robust security measures must be implemented to minimize risks FAQs 1 Q How can I identify a malicious USB drive A Look for unusual or unfamiliar markings and avoid any USB drives that seem to have come from untrusted sources 2 Q What should I do if I suspect a keylogger attack A Disconnect the USB drive immediately and report the incident to IT or security personnel 3 Q Can keyloggers be detected by antivirus software A Some antivirus solutions can detect and remove keyloggers but advanced malware often employs techniques to evade detection 4 Q Are there different levels of keyloggers A Yes keyloggers vary in sophistication some targeting specific applications others capturing a broader spectrum of data 5 Q How can I strengthen my password security A Use strong unique passwords for each account and consider using password managers to securely store and manage them By understanding the mechanics of a USB keylogger attack and implementing appropriate countermeasures individuals and organizations can significantly reduce their vulnerability to this increasingly prevalent threat Unmasking the Stealthy Intruder Analyzing a USB Keylogger Attack The quiet hum of a seemingly innocuous USB drive can mask a sinister threat A USB keylogger cleverly disguised as a regular data storage device can silently record everything typed on an infected computer This article delves into the intricate mechanics of a USB keylogger attack exploring its vulnerabilities the damage it inflicts and crucial defensive measures 4 Understanding the Tactics of a USB Keylogger Attack A USB keylogger attack often leverages the ubiquitous nature of USB drives to infiltrate a system The attacker strategically crafts a seemingly harmless USB drive often containing legitimatelooking files or applications This deception allows the malicious program to install itself on the system unnoticed The Infection Process Once inserted the keylogger software establishes itself within the operating system typically by utilizing hidden processes or leveraging system vulnerabilities This covert behavior is critical to the attackers stealthy operation The software then passively records keystrokes timestamps and other pertinent data Example A USB drive labeled Project Reports containing a seemingly legitimate spreadsheet file but actually hiding a keylogger Once plugged in the keylogger silently installs itself starting its insidious data collection Sophistication Levels The sophistication of keylogger attacks varies greatly Basic keyloggers may simply record text input while more advanced ones might capture screenshots log mouse movements and even monitor web browsing activity Technical Analysis of a Keylogger Attack Malicious Code and Payload The heart of the USB keylogger attack lies in the malicious code or payload embedded within the seemingly harmless files on the USB drive This payload could be a selfextracting archive or a compiled executable that automatically installs and runs the keylogger upon execution Technical Example A JAR file disguised as a report could actually contain Java code that executes the keylogger System Dependencies The success of a keylogger attack often relies on the systems vulnerabilities like outdated operating systems lacking antivirus software or insufficient user awareness Identifying and Mitigating the Threats Defensive Strategies Defense against USB keylogger attacks involves multiple layers of security Educating users about potential threats is paramount Furthermore robust security measures at the system 5 level can significantly reduce the risk of infection User Education Regular training and awareness programs for employees on identifying phishing attempts and the risks associated with unverified USB drives Preventive Measures Implementing secure access policies and regular software updates for both operating systems and antimalware solutions are essential Restricting physical access to USB ports in sensitive areas can also be a proactive step Example Training employees to thoroughly scrutinize file names extensions and origins of any USB drive before connecting it to their systems RealWorld Applications Case Studies Impact on Business and Individuals The impact of a successful USB keylogger attack can range from minor data breaches to significant corporate espionage Compromised login credentials sensitive financial information or confidential intellectual property can be stolen Case Study A consulting firm experienced a severe security breach when a USB keylogger was planted on one of the staffs laptops The attacker successfully obtained confidential client information and intellectual property causing reputational damage and financial loss Conclusion USB keylogger attacks pose a serious threat to both individuals and organizations Awareness education and proactive security measures are critical in preventing such intrusions Regular software updates strong passwords and a vigilant approach to USB drive usage are critical to minimizing risk Advanced FAQs 1 Can a keylogger be detected by antivirus software Yes many modern antivirus programs can detect and remove keyloggers but their effectiveness depends on the sophistication of the keylogger 2 What data types are commonly targeted by keyloggers Anything that can be typed on a keyboard including passwords credit card numbers financial data or confidential documents 3 How does a keylogger differ from a RAT While both programs can steal information Remote Access Trojans RATs offer remote control over the infected system potentially enabling more malicious actions Keyloggers are primarily focused on data capture 6 4 Can keylogger attacks be performed remotely In some cases a keylogger can be remotely deployed on a system through exploiting existing vulnerabilities or by tricking users into downloading infected software 5 What is the role of encryption in combating USB keylogger attacks Encrypting sensitive data and files on the system can make stolen data less valuable to an attacker This comprehensive analysis provides a detailed understanding of USB keylogger attacks enabling a multifaceted approach to safeguarding against such threats Security is a continuous process that requires ongoing vigilance and adaptation to evolving cyberthreats
